Comparison Results
| Metric | $25,982 | $83,039 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| $25,982 | $83,039 | $57,057 |
| Federal Tax | $1,098 | $9,883 | $8,784 |
| State Tax | $0 | $0 | $0 |
| FICA (SS + Medicare) | $1,988 | $6,352 | $4,365 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| $22,896 | $66,804 | $43,908 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| $1,908 | $5,567 | $3,659 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 11.9% | 19.6% | 7.7% |

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 10%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.
State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
